Ciabatta is a Mediterranean and rural bread, an integral part of Italian gastronomy. Its peculiarity lies in its lean, very liquid and moist dough (70%), prepared on the basis of olive oil (3 to 5%), water and specific sourdough (biga). This gives it a well-honeycombed and fluffy crumb, a thin and slightly crispy crust. With our mould, make loaves of 250 g each, gourmet enough to obtain beautiful even slices.
